About the role

The Technical Accounting Lead serves as an experienced technical accounting specialist, leading complex technical initiatives and providing advanced guidance on accounting standards compliance. This role combines deep technical expertise with process leadership responsibilities, mentoring junior staff while driving process improvements and serving as a key resource for challenging technical accounting matters.

What you’ll be doing

Advanced Technical Leadership & Process Development

  • Lead technical accounting expertise for complex areas including advanced lease accounting, revenue recognition, consolidations, and emerging accounting standards
  • Drive research and implementation of new accounting pronouncements, leading cross-functional project teams
  • Develop and maintain advanced accounting policies and procedures, ensuring consistency and compliance
  • Provide authoritative technical guidance on complex accounting matters to stakeholders across the organization
  • Lead evaluation of accounting implications for complex business transactions and initiatives

    Process Leadership & Technical Excellence

    • Lead technical accounting training programs and knowledge sharing initiatives across the organization
    • Drive technical capability building across the Technical Accounting team and broader organization
    • Lead process improvement initiatives for complex technical accounting workflows
    • Establish technical accounting performance metrics and quality standards
    • Champion automation and efficiency improvements in technical accounting processes

    Complex Corporate Functions & Project Management

    • Lead accounting for the most complex corporate functions and intercompany structures
    • Drive design and implementation of intercompany pricing models and allocation methodologies
    • Lead complex business combination accounting and purchase price allocation projects
    • Provide technical accounting support for M&A transactions, divestitures, and restructuring initiatives
    • Lead analysis of complex corporate cost structures and profitability models
    • Support Finance Accounting teams and FP&A with understanding of technical processes and their impact in the financials

    Advanced Audit & Compliance Management

    • Lead technical accounting discussions with external auditors and provide expert support for complex matters
    • Drive resolution of complex technical accounting issues and audit findings
    • Support Technical Accounting Principal in regulatory and HQ technical discussions
    • Lead internal control design and testing for complex technical accounting areas
    • Provide expert support for regulatory filing requirements and technical documentation
About you

Education & Experience

  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ting or Finance; CPA strongly preferred, MBA preferred
  • Minimum 6 years of progressive technical accounting experience with demonstrated process leadership capabilities
  • Public accounting experience with senior associate or manager-level experience strongly preferred
  • Multi-entity and international accounting experience preferred
  • Track record of leading complex technical accounting projects and initiatives

Advanced Technical Skills

  • Expert-level knowledge of US GAAP, FASB ASC, and SEC reporting requirements
  • Advanced expertise in complex accounting standards including ASC 842, ASC 606, ASC 805, and consolidation guidance
  • Experience with advanced technical accounting research and position development
  • Proven track record with complex business transaction accounting
  • Advanced knowledge of internal controls and SOX compliance requirements

Core Competencies

  • Advanced Technical Excellence: Expert-level technical accounting knowledge with ability to resolve complex issues and lead technical initiatives
  • Process Leadership: Proven ability to lead technical initiatives and drive process improvements across the organization
  • Technical Communication: Exceptional ability to communicate complex technical matters to diverse stakeholders
  • Project Management: Experience leading cross-functional technical projects and managing complex implementations

Mentoring Excellence: Strong ability to develop technical expertise in others and drive capability building
